About Fabian Weber
Fabian Weber is a scholar working on Biochemistry, Food Science, Plant Science, Molecular Biology and Nutrition and Dietetics, having authored 52 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Phytochemicals and Antioxidant Activities (32 papers), Fermentation and Sensory Analysis (27 papers), Horticultural and Viticultural Research (18 papers), Botanical Research and Applications (6 papers), Biochemical Analysis and Sensing Techniques (5 papers), Chromatography in Natural Products (4 papers), Microencapsulation and Drying Processes (3 papers) and Polysaccharides and Plant Cell Walls (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(557 citations), Food Science (671 cit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(187 citations), Plant Science (427 citations) and Biotechnology (98 citations). Fabian Weber has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and Bulgaria. Frequent co-authors include Andreas Schieber, Lara Etzbach, Anne Pfeiffer, Peter Winterhalter, Dominik Durner, Ulrich Fischer, Carolin Klein, Stephan Sommer, James F. Harbertson and Gottfried Sedelmeier.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ry, Food Research International, American Journal of Enology and Viticulture, European Food Research and Technology and Food Chemistry.
